Головна Популярне Увійти Зареєструватися Про проект Ми у Facebook

Ключі + Типи Звʼязків (1-1, 1-m, n-m, self-join)

Влоги
Опубліковано: 23 черв. 2022 р.
Підписатися
21-те заняття тренувальної програми Ultimate Enterprise Java (2021).
УВАГА! Відеозапис не містить активної частини заняття.
👉 Реєструйся на вебінар: https://www.bobocode.com/learn

____________________________________________
Patreon: https://www.patreon.com/bobocode
GitHub: https://github.com/bobocode-projects
Telegram: https://t.me/bobocode
LinkedIn: https://bit.ly/2RWPQF5
Twitter: https://bit.ly/3vaQiOl
Тарас в LinkedIn: https://bit.ly/2ElWg8J
Тарас в Twitter: https://bit.ly/33Pmuwg
____________________________________________

00:00 - Нарізка основних моментів
03:18 - Початок
03:38 - Порядок денний
04:12 - Лінійне VS. залишкове навчання
08:33 - Манупуляція обмеженнями (Constraints)
08:37 - Як ідентифікувати ключ?
10:02 - Конвенція найменувань ключів
11:08 - Чому важливо називати ключі?
11:26 - Як називає ключі PostgreSQL?
14:02 - Як називає ключі MySQL?
18:32 - Як змінити обмеження?
19:38 - Що важливо розуміти про БД?
19:58 - БД зберігає метадані в таблицях
20:31 - Читаємо документацію PostgreSQL
20:57 - Де зберігаються метадані таблиць?
22:04 - Таблиця pg_constraint
22:56 - Витягуємо метадані таблиці "notes"
25:00 - Змінюємо назву ключа в таблиці pg_contraints
31:02 - Документація VS. Книжки
32:18 - Різні способи створення ключів
34:48 - ЗВʼЯЗКИ МІЖ ТАБЛИЦЯМИ
34:55 - One To Many
35:44 - Приклади One To Many
36:54 - One To One
38:40 - Приклади One To One
38:49 - One To One (shared PK)
45:32 - Many To Many
48:49 - Приклади Many To Many
49:01 - Self-Joining One To Many
50:10 - Self-Joining Many To Many
51:12 - Ключ до розуміння всіх звʼязків
52:36 - Створюємо табличку users
53:38 - Створюємо табличку videos
54:54 - Створюємо табличку comments
56:38 - Створюємо табличку user_friends
58:15 - Додаємо дані в таблиці

#opensource #java #education
розгорнути опис
згорнути опис

Можливо зацікавить